Cavan dispose of Roscommon with ease

Cavan 0-14 Roscommon 0-6, Kingspan Breffni Park

Seanie Johnston was impressive for the hosts as Cavan claimed a well-merited NFL Division 3 victory over Roscommon at Kingspan Breffni Park.

Johnston scored five of Cavan’s first half points as Tommy Carr’s charges were certainly the more clinical outfit in the opening half - they held a 0-6 to 0-4 interval lead.

The sides were level on three occasions inside the opening 19 minutes, with Johnston accounting for all of Cavan’s first three points, while Roscommon free-taker Senan Kilbride did likewise for the visitors.

Cavan placed huge pressure on the Roscommon defence, but failed to find a way past Roscommon goalkeeper Geoffrey Claffey who pulled off a fine save midway through the half.

Roscommon’s poor shooting cost them dearly with Fergal O’Donnell’s side amassing eight first half wides, including one from goalkeeper Claffey three minutes into injury-time.

The visitors had a 23-minute spell without scoring in the opening half, and their fortunes failed to improve on the restart as Cavan opened up a 0-8 to 0-4 gap.

Sean Purcell opened Roscommon’s second half account, eight minutes after the restart, but his side were dealt a major blow at that stage following the dismissal of Jonathan Dunning on a straight red card.

Points from Larry and Martin Reilly ensured Cavan opened up a 0-12 to

0-06 lead, and although the Breffni side kicked five second half wides they finished strongly to ensure a comfortable win in the end.
